OP Stack is an open source modular blockchain development framework launched by Optimism to help developers build Ethereum compatible Layer 2 networks. By modularizing functions such as the execution layer, settlement layer, sequencing layer, and data availability layer, OP Stack lowers the barrier to developing Rollup networks and provides a unified technical standard for multi-chain coordination.

Optimism and Arbitrum are both Layer 2 scaling networks built on Ethereum, and both use Optimistic Rollup technology to reduce transaction costs and increase network throughput. However, they differ significantly in technical implementation, governance systems, ecosystem strategies, and developer frameworks. Optimism focuses on developing the OP Stack and Superchain ecosystem, while Arbitrum advances scalability through Arbitrum Orbit and a multi layer Rollup architecture.

Superchain and Polygon AggLayer are both infrastructure solutions designed to address liquidity fragmentation, fragmented user experiences, and cross chain interoperability in the multi-chain blockchain ecosystem. However, they take different development paths. Superchain is driven by Optimism and connects multiple Layer 2 networks through the unified technical standard of OP Stack. Polygon AggLayer connects different types of blockchain networks through aggregated proofs and a unified settlement layer.

Optimism is an Ethereum Layer 2 scaling network built on Optimistic Rollup technology. It is designed to reduce transaction costs, increase transaction throughput, and inherit Ethereum’s security. As blockchain applications continue to scale, Optimism moves large volumes of transactions off chain for processing, then submits the results to the Ethereum mainnet, allowing the network to operate more efficiently.

Collector Crypt’s Gacha Machine is an on-chain collectibles distribution system based on random rewards. After users purchase a Gacha Pack, the system allocates collectible card NFTs of different tiers according to preset probabilities. These NFTs correspond to physical cards custodied in the Vault. The entire process combines the traditional trading card pack opening experience, NFT ownership management, and on-chain market liquidity mechanisms.

Collector Crypt is a Web3 platform focused on tokenizing physical trading cards. It converts authenticated and custodied physical cards into on-chain NFTs, enabling collectibles to be traded, held, and transferred digitally. By combining a Vault custody system, Gacha pack opening, and an on-chain marketplace, the platform gives the traditional trading card market greater liquidity and broader access to global trading.

Meta’s advertising business is the main source of revenue for platforms such as Facebook and Instagram, and it is also the core business model of Meta Platforms. Unlike traditional media, which sells fixed advertising space, Meta connects advertisers with users through a data driven ad auction system, allowing ads to appear at the right time in front of people who are more likely to show interest or take action.

The Average Directional Index (ADX) is a technical analysis indicator used to evaluate the strength of a price trend without identifying its direction. As financial markets have become increasingly structured and data-driven, ADX has gained widespread use in distinguishing trending conditions from sideways movement.
